She wants to share her faith in God by transmitting an oral history, which is the way of her ancient world. Angelique’s first language is Cree, a rarity in the latter day generations of First Nations in Canada. Up until the age of 9 she spoke Cree almost exclusively, and until she was age 15 Angie had a difficult time getting access to any English whatsoever in her journey through the wilderness of northern Manitoba.Perseverance is what you will learn from Angie. She takes no half measures in life, and when the time came for her to get serious about learning English Angie sought learning from the first book in the language, The Holy Bible.The Lord has opened doors for Angie, and she recollects a life-long relationship with God. She believes in worshipping Christ with Evangelical devotion. She thanks God for a full life that continues to offer challenges and rewards in day-tight compartments.Âhkameyihtamowin: perseveranceAngie has two important scriptures that she lives by from Proverbs and a favourite from 1 Corinthians. These are found at the back of the book. We hope you enjoy the journey there.
